How they compare

Luxembourg currently reports 76.4% against 49.8% in High income, a difference of 26.6%.

That makes Luxembourg's figure about 1.5 times High income's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Luxembourg ahead.

High income ranks 6th and Luxembourg ranks 3rd of 47 groups.

Across the 3 decades both report, High income averaged higher in 1 and Luxembourg in 2.

Number of male deaths ages 5-14 due to non-communicable diseases divided by number of all male deaths ages 5-14, expressed by percentage. Non-Communicable diseases include cancer, diabetes mellitus, cardiovascular diseases, digestive diseases, skin diseases, musculoskeletal diseases, and congenital anomalies.
